import { useNamespace } from 'element-plus/es/hooks/use-namespace/index.mjs'; import { useFormItem } from 'element-plus/es/components/form/src/hooks/use-form-item.mjs'; import { usePropsAlias } from './composables/use-props-alias.mjs'; import { useComputedData } from './composables/...
constoneItem = {component: Input } 这时候,我们就需要动态组件去渲染它,因此我们可以这样写去渲染,当component是一个字符串,比如el-input的时候,我们渲染element的input组件,至于v-model这些我就省略了 <el-form-itemv-for="item in items":key="item.key"> <el-inputv-if="item.component === 'el-inp...
import{ElInput,ElSelect}from"element-plus"import{FormItem,useFormConfigProvide}from"@usaform/element-plus"constapp=createApp(App)useFormConfigProvide({Elements:{ElInput,ElSelect,FormItem,}},app) useFormConfigProvide提供了全局注册的能力,第一个参数和<Form/>组件的 config 参数一模一样 该hook可以...
export default (app) => { app.use(ElButton) app.use(ElForm) app.use(ElFormItem) app.use(ElInput) app.use(ElRow) app.use(ElContainer) app.use(ElHeader) app.use(ElAside) app.use(ElMain) app.use(ElMenu) app.use(ElSubmenu) app.use(ElMenuItem) app.use(ElIcon) app.use(ElBreadc...
app.use(ElementPlus) 1. 2. 3. 4. 步骤二:使用 element plus 的 form 可以拷贝官网:https://element-plus.org/zh-CN/component/form.html 步骤三:form 明确指定 rules <el-form :model="formData" label-width="90px" :rules="rules"> <el-form-item label="用户" prop="account"> ...
.el-form-item__label { font-size: 16px; } 常用组件详解 按钮组件(Button) 按钮组件是最常用的组件之一,提供了多种样式和功能。 <template> <el-button type="primary">Primary Button</el-button> <el-button type="success" plain>Success Button</el-button> ...
<el-form-item label="时间"> <el-date-picker v-model="formInline.date" type="date" placeholder="选择时间" clearable /> </el-form-item> <el-form-item> <el-button type="primary" @click="onSubmit">查询</el-button> </el-form-item> ...
表单组件(Form) 表单组件的使用示例 表单组件用于创建各种表单,支持表单验证和提交。 <template> <el-form :model="ruleForm" :rules="rules" ref="ruleForm" label-width="100px" class="demo-ruleForm"> <el-form-item label="用户名" prop="username"> <el-input v-model="ruleForm.username"></el...
<el-form-item label="环境"> <el-select v-model="form.env" placeholder="请选择环境"> <el-option label="sit" value="sit"></el-option> <el-option label="uat" value="uat"></el-option> <el-option label="dev" value="dev"></el-option> ...
159 export { useFormItem, useFormItemProps } from './hooks/use-form-item/index.mjs'; 160 export { useSameTarget } from './hooks/use-same-target/index.mjs'; 161 export { useGlobalConfig } from './hooks/use-global-config/index.mjs'; 162 export { elFormItemKey, elFormKey } ...